9 killed, 13 wounded in Turkey school shooting — second attack in 24 hours

ALBAWABA- Nine people were killed and 13 others injured, six critically, in a school shooting at Ayser Çalık Secondary School in the Onikişubat district of Kahramanmaraş province, southeastern Turkey, officials said Wednesday. Interior Minister Mustafa Ciftci confirmed the toll, stating that emergency teams rushed the wounded to nearby hospitals, where several remain in intensive care.
